Your Ingredients List
- 1 cup cream cheese, softened
- 1/2 cup Greek yogurt
- 1/4 cup honey or maple syrup
- 1/4 cup lemon juice
- zest of 1 lemon
- 1 cup blueberries
- 1/2 cup graham cracker crumbs
- 2 tablespoons melted butter
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
My Go-To Equipment
I use my small muffin tin and paper liners to make even cups. A bowl and a hand mixer make the filling smooth. I keep a small spoon or cookie scoop for even portions.
The Simple Steps to Follow
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Mix graham cracker crumbs and melted butter in a small bowl.
- Press crumbs into the bottom of mini cheesecake cups.
- Beat cream cheese, Greek yogurt, honey, lemon juice, lemon zest, and vanilla until smooth.
- Fold in the blueberries gently.
- Spoon the filling into the prepared crusts.
- Bake for 10 to 12 minutes until set.
- Let cool, then chill in the fridge for at least 2 hours.

Getting It Just Right
Use softened cream cheese so the filling is smooth. Fold the blueberries carefully to avoid crushing them. The cakes should feel set at the edges and slightly jiggly in the center when done.
How to Store Leftovers
Cover the cheesecakes and keep them in the fridge for up to 3 days. They hold their shape if you chill them well. Do not freeze unless you wrap them tightly, as blueberries can get soft.

A Few Common Questions
Can I make Healthy Mini Lemon Blueberry Cheesecakes ahead of time?
Yes, you can make Healthy Mini Lemon Blueberry Cheesecakes ahead. Bake them a day before and chill them overnight for the best texture.
Can I use frozen blueberries in Healthy Mini Lemon Blueberry Cheesecakes?
You can use frozen blueberries, but do not thaw them fully to avoid extra juice. Toss them in a little flour before folding to help keep the filling from turning blue.
Why are my Healthy Mini Lemon Blueberry Cheesecakes runny?
If the filling is runny after baking, chill longer. The fridge helps the cream cheese and yogurt firm up, so give them the full two hours or more.
